Kraft Heinz (KHC) Operating Expenses (2016 - 2025)

Kraft Heinz's Operating Expenses history spans 13 years, with the latest figure at $988.0 million for Q4 2025.

  • For the quarter ending Q4 2025, Operating Expenses fell 56.76% year-over-year to $988.0 million, compared with a TTM value of $13.0 billion through Dec 2025, up 78.15%, and an annual FY2025 reading of $13.0 billion, up 78.15% over the prior year.
  • Operating Expenses for Q4 2025 was $988.0 million at Kraft Heinz, up from $965.0 million in the prior quarter.
  • The five-year high for Operating Expenses was $10.2 billion in Q2 2025, with the low at $816.0 million in Q1 2022.
  • Average Operating Expenses over 5 years is $1.7 billion, with a median of $1.1 billion recorded in 2021.
  • Year-over-year, Operating Expenses crashed 72.14% in 2021 and then surged 473.19% in 2025.
  • Tracing KHC's Operating Expenses over 5 years: stood at $2.2 billion in 2021, then crashed by 47.85% to $1.1 billion in 2022, then fell by 10.63% to $1.0 billion in 2023, then soared by 124.68% to $2.3 billion in 2024, then tumbled by 56.76% to $988.0 million in 2025.
  • Per Business Quant, the three most recent readings for KHC's Operating Expenses are $988.0 million (Q4 2025), $965.0 million (Q3 2025), and $10.2 billion (Q2 2025).
